Overview of the Lifeline Program
Lifeline is a program established by the Federal Communications Commission (FCC) in 1985 to assist low-income consumers by subsidizing the cost of phone, internet, or bundled services.
Eligible participants can receive monthly discounts of up to $9.25 and enjoy special deals on telecommunication services.
Specific program participation also indicate that you automatically qualify for Lifeline services.
For example, if you are enrolled in SNAP (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program) and have an EBT card, you automatically qualify for the Lifeline program and its associated benefits.
Participating in SNAP makes applying for Lifeline much easier, as you only need to provide proof of your SNAP participation. There’s no need to submit additional income verification or evidence of enrollment in other assistance programs.

2. How Can I Get a Free Tablet with EBT?
Eligibility criteria
To receive a free tablet from a service provider through the Lifeline program, you must meet certain income requirements or participate in qualifying assistance programs.
If you are a SNAP participant and hold an EBT card, you are automatically eligible for Lifeline without the need for additional income verification. You simply need to provide proof of SNAP participation, confirmed by an authorized agency.
Even if you’re not enrolled in SNAP, you may still be eligible for Lifeline by fulfilling one of these alternative criteria:
- You are enrolled in other government assistance programs such as Medicaid, SSI, or Federal Public Housing Assistance.
- Your household earnings align with or are below 135% of the poverty line set by federal guidelines.
Step-by-step registration
Once you’ve confirmed your eligibility, follow these steps to register and receive your free tablet:
Step 1: Verify eligibility and prepare documents
Gather SNAP participation proof, such as:
- Recent Notices of Action
- Notices of Approval
- Valid Verification of Benefits Letters
If applying based on income, you’ll need to submit documents such as pay stubs, tax returns, or equivalent income verification.
Step 2: Submit your Lifeline application
You have two options for submitting your application:
- Through the National Verifier portal: Visit nv.fcc.gov to complete the application and upload your verification documents.
- Through a service provider: Many providers have their own registration portals where you can enter your information and upload verification documents directly.
Step 3: Choose a service provider and device
Once approved, you can select a service provider and choose your device. Some providers offer a list of available tablets, such as Samsung Galaxy Tab or older models of iPad.
Step 4: Delivery and activation
If your application is approved, your device will be shipped within 7–14 business days. To keep enjoying your Lifeline service, you’ll need to use it at least once every 30 days.
